316 =head2 SelfLoaded methods
318 Those methods which override default MM_Unix methods are marked
319 "(override)", while methods unique to MM_VMS are marked "(specific)".
320 For overridden methods, documentation is limited to an explanation
321 of why this method overrides the MM_Unix method; see the ExtUtils::MM_Unix
322 documentation for more details.

461 =item maybe_command (override)
463 Follows VMS naming conventions for executable files.
464 If the name passed in doesn't exactly match an executable file,
465 appends F<.Exe> (or equivalent) to check for executable image, and F<.Com>
466 to check for DCL procedure. If this fails, checks directories in DCL$PATH
467 and finally F<Sys$System:> for an executable file having the name specified,
468 with or without the F<.Exe>-equivalent suffix.

780 =item cflags (override)
782 Bypass shell script and produce qualifiers for CC directly (but warn
783 user if a shell script for this extension exists). Fold multiple
784 /Defines into one, since some C compilers pay attention to only one
785 instance of this qualifier on the command line.

882 =item pm_to_blib (override)
884 DCL I<still> accepts a maximum of 255 characters on a command
885 line, so we write the (potentially) long list of file names
886 to a temp file, then persuade Perl to read it instead of the
887 command line to find args.

2120 =item makeaperl (override)
2122 Undertake to build a new set of Perl images using VMS commands. Since
2123 VMS does dynamic loading, it's not necessary to statically link each
2124 extension into the Perl image, so this isn't the normal build path.
2125 Consequently, it hasn't really been tested, and may well be incomplete.
